Police Officer Salary in Key West, FL: $69,510 (2026)
Quick Answer:A full-time police officer in Key West, FL earns a median $69,510/year (≈ $33.42/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 33-3051). Once you factor in Key West's price level (1% above national, BEA RPP 100.8), that paycheck buys what $68,958 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 1.5% below the Florida state average.

Salary Trajectory for Police Officers in Key West (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 3.06%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$55,888 | Actual |
| 2020 | $58,003 | Actual |
| 2021 | $57,180 | Actual |
| 2022 | $58,224 | Actual |
| 2023 | $63,968 | Actual |
| 2024 | $61,579 | Actual |
| 2025 | $67,446 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$69,510 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$71,637 | Projected |
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Key West metropolitan area, the median police officer salary grew 20.7% from $55,888 (2019) to $67,446 (2025). At a 3.06%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$71,637 by 2027 — a total increase of $15,749 (28.18%) from 2019.
Note: Historical values (2019–2025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Key West met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 2026–2026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 3.06%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data.
